Output e26af188b38d63136eee7a58cf6610cc58939f20837f42d113926e3f4ffda611:0

value
130069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c529ed687431029552e6a00f5f476e6c65da08 OP_EQUAL
address
3JMR6ds7pxPRfLz2KXDN3MDyz5LyRgF5Ex
transaction
e26af188b38d63136eee7a58cf6610cc58939f20837f42d113926e3f4ffda611
spent
true